We can get the indices of the starting and the ending strings inside the main string with the String.IndexOf () function. We can then extract the text between both strings by passing both words’ indices to the String.SubString () function.

WebNov 29, 2024 · To get the mid part of a string that begins at a specific index, we call the Substring() method on that string. We provide that method with one argument: the start index. The pattern for that looks like: input.Substring(index). This has the string method return all characters from that index till the end of that string. Here’s how that looks ... WebMar 11, 2024 · In C#, there is no way to perform the 'slice' or 'ranges' for collections. There is no way to skip and take data without using LINQ methods. So, there's a new way, i.e., using the new range operator 'x..y'. We call this '..' operator the 'Range Operator'. The above example 'x' is nothing but starting index and 'y' is the ending index. WebFeb 19, 2024 · An example. We use IndexOf to see if a string contains a word. Usually we want to know the exact result of IndexOf. We can store its result in an int local. Part 1 IndexOf returns the location of the string "dog." It is located at index 4. Part 2 We test the result of IndexOf against the special constant -1.
